Joshua Caputo - Head Brewer

Let us introduce to you the reason our beer tastes so good! After attending the American Brewers Guild (VT), Josh found himself honing his craft with over 8 years of professional brewing experience at places such as Duck Rabbit Brewery (NC) and Saint Benjamins Brewery (PA) before coming to brew for us. Josh’s range of brewing knows no bounds but his favorite styles to brew are Czech Pilsners and West Coast IPA’s. If he’s not out brewing, Josh likes to hang with his wife Tessa and cats Oppenheimer, Tanis, and Schrodinger, tend to his vegetable garden, and play board games. Make sure to show him some love for all he puts into brewing!

Favorite Beer Style(s): Czech Pilsner - West Coast IPA

Booking and Reservations

Dr. Brewlittle’s is now accepting booking requests for your indoor and outdoor space! Check out the information below for how to contact us and pricing!

As of right now we are only accepting reservations for private events. Give us a ring or shoot us a contact form with the date and time. We have limited seating for large parties and will work with you to make sure that you can grab a spot! For any party of 10+ a gratuity of 20% will be added to the bill.

Interested in reserving the indoor/outdoor space for a party? We’ve got you covered! Availability and pricing are as follows:
—Our second floor and balcony is available for reservations up to 35 people. To reserve the space, it is $275 (Sunday-Thursday) or $400 (Friday/Saturday) for up to 4 hours. Anything longer please let us know and we will work with you on your event!
—You may bring in outside wine/non-alcoholoic beverages for private events. There is a $20 uncorking fee/bottle of wine. NO OUTSIDE BEER/SPIRITS
—Reservation charges are non-refundable. If Covid state mandates prevent us from hosting your party at any point we will refund the deposit.
—For parties of 10+, a mandatory 20% gratuity is due at the end of the night.
—You are more than welcome to bring in any food you would like for the event as we do not serve food at the brewery.
—We are animal friendly as long as the owners are well behaved!
—If you are interested in reserving the brewery on a day we aren’t open, or the entire space, please head over to our contact page and let us know!
